Illegitimacy and Social Struggles in the 18th Century

This chapter examines the lives of illegitimate children born to a king in the late 18th century, revealing their unique societal status and personal battles. Through letters and historical context, it illustrates the emotional turmoil stemming from their illegitimacy while also reflecting on shifting attitudes towards sexual culture and the establishment of the Foundling Hospital. Additionally, the chapter contrasts the experiences of illegitimate boys and girls, highlighting the influence of social class and gender on their opportunities and challenges.
